What is The Playful Polar Bears (1938) about?

A group of hunters ventures into a polar bear's snowy home, accidentally creating chaos when they disrupt a playful cub's antics. Fearing for its baby's safety, the parent bear must act fast to turn the tide—delivering a mix of humor and heartwarming rescue in this vintage animated short.

Who directed The Playful Polar Bears?

Dave Fleischer, the legendary animator and director behind beloved *Popeye* and *Betty Boop* shorts, helmed *The Playful Polar Bears*. Known for his innovative animation style, Fleischer crafted a visually engaging and playful narrative in this 1938 film.

About The Playful Polar Bears (1938) — A Fleischer Animation Classic with Arctic Adventures

Step into the icy heart of the Arctic in *The Playful Polar Bears (1938)*, Dave Fleischer's charming eight-minute animated short that blends gentle humor with heartwarming family dynamics. Directed by the visionary behind *Popeye* classics, this short film follows a curious group of hunters who stumble into a lively polar bear community—only to find themselves in a whimsical (and slightly perilous) adventure. The story centers on a devoted parent bear racing against time to rescue its playful cub from the unexpected visitors, delivering a mix of slapstick antics and tender moments. Animated in the signature Fleischer style, the film captures the frosty beauty of the Arctic while delivering a lighthearted yet engaging narrative.
